Being Successful in the Turbulent World of Modeling
Being able to adapt to change is the one true constant while making ongoing steps to becoming a model. Like every other business, models have to play the aggressive game to stay one step ahead. So, although it is natural to feel anxious, if you want to remain on top, take note of the following steps:
You must embrace these steps to becoming a model. Change happens, so be enthusiastic about it. Certainly don't panic, even if you identify a threat from a new and younger model. Take note of how people react to her and construct ways in which to get people talking about you again. Chat with friends about the new kid and maybe request additional support from agencies you've previously worked with to boost your profile. If you've cultivated a relationship with an honest talent agency, they will act as you advisor and help you find the right jobs for your particular skills.
Putting together a support team that you trust is fundamental to pushing on with your ongoing steps to continue being a model as they'll be invaluable when building up an idea of how to make use of any sea change in the world of modeling. Keep the overall plan straightforward, though. Not every change has to involve a major upheaval, but prepared to gain or lose weight as necessary.
With a strong game plan in place for the ongoing steps to continue being a model, you must promote it by creating an all-new portfolio to gain invites for and being photographed at as many of the prestigious parties and influential events as possible.
Anyone in your team not giving you 100% support must be let go. However, all steadfast supporters deserve to be rewarded, and that means for the little successes early in your process of change as that promotes even greater loyalty and passion. Being photographed entering one of those big parties you attend should let you provide a bonus to your staff and at the same time prove wrong the naysayers that believed you were finished.
The establishment of many small targets makes your big goal more achievable in everyone's eyes. Therefore, consider recruiting help from agencies, newspapers and magazines that you have a good relationship with to keep you in the public eye, particularly early in your plan.
Remember, all the little victories are part of a grander scheme on the road to sustainable success. You're striving for long-term accomplishments, so be prepared to make alterations whenever necessary. That could even mean changing modeling agencies if needs be.
In fact, being seen to embrace change could become the very characteristic that epitomizes you and brings in steady work during the ongoing steps to continue being a model. But don't forget to thank those that helped you along the way. Good will can go a long way when asking for favors. It's wise to remember that change is seen as fresh and challenging and will let you enjoy a long and successful career.
